Reader Mail: Becoming a Tattoo Artist

Sunday November 8, 2009
"I have been doing some research on tattooing, because i really would like to pursue it. Your writing really helped me understand what i needed to do. i just wanted to thank you, and ask for any other advice you might give me to achieve my dream." - Andrew

I'm guessing you've already read all of the following articles about becoming a tattoo artist:

Other than the information provided in those articles, the only other advice I would give is not to give up. It can be a slow and frustrating process, and it's very tempting to cut corners or cheat to get to the end faster. But if you remain patient and you stay on the path, no matter how long, it will pay off in the end. If this is something you really want to do, then it's worth putting forth the effort to do it right.
